The Florida jury just came back with a verdict awarding Hulk Hogan $115 million in his case with Gawker Media. The case will obviously be appealed and there is very little chance he will be getting anything close to that figure. But the verdict sends a strong message to the media regarding publishing sex tapes of people without their consent ...
Gawker would have to post $50 million to take it to the appeals court, which makes that aspect tricky as well, as the verdict could force the company into either bankruptcy or sale. There was a great deal of potential evidence Gawker was hoping to introduce that didn't make the trial due to the rulings of judge Pamela Campbell and Gawker is going to use that in its appeal.

WWE has announced on Twitter that Cesaro will be returning to the ring during the WrestleMania Revenge tour in Europe next month.
Cesaro will be in-action at the April 15th live event in Amsterdam, Netherlands at the Ziggo Dome, which indicates he will be wrestling at the other shows on the tour. Cesaro has noted in recent interviews that he will not be cleared in time to compete at WrestleMania.

On Monday's RAW it was advertised that the WWE Network will feature 7 hours of WrestleMania coverage and the Hall of Fame ceremony, but NXT Takeover: Dallas got no mention. Dave Meltzer of the Wrestling Observer Newsletter reports that a lot of people within the company are openly unhappy that the NXT event was not promoted on RAW.
Either someone simply forgot to include NXT Takeover in their WrestleMania week lineup, or someone in WWE felt it wasn't important enough. One conspiracy theory is that Kevin Dunn may have made the decision to leave Takeover off the promotional video on RAW. NXT is considered to be Triple H's project, and Dunn has nothing to do with the NXT product.
Meltzer noted that the feeling within WWE is that Dunn will likely be let go when Triple H and Stephanie McMahon eventually take over the company.
